Supports secure remote authentication and provides comprehensive user activity tracking
The most important feature is the security capability because it provides a substantial amount of security for admin-related activities. Fortinet FortiAuthenticator can be used from anywhere in the world, and the authenticator services function globally. This global accessibility is one of the critical advantages, particularly since admin features are critical and security is a real concern. With Fortinet FortiAuthenticator, secure usage of firewall services and related functions is achieved. A complete log of all users who access the authenticator setup is maintained. Monthly logs are reviewed to check for any unnoticed activities. Each authenticated user's complete activity history is recorded. This logging capability allows for providing access to more admin users while ensuring security is not compromised and all users can be monitored.

Good authentication options, but the setup can be complex and the user interface should be improved
Many of the users with licenses are not getting their IPs all of the time. It seems that the licenses are not active on the user end. There are multiple errors. At times, when the user is trying to scan and activate the license, it comes up with an error code. The user interface could be improved. The setup could be simplified. The mobile app that is available for Digipass does not scan the QR code to activate the license. Users would like to see more functions and creation options for the user base and the UI console. They are not getting all of the features that are available on the UI Console. The features are the same but they are not able to configure them.
